Property Overview: 411 Ferry Road, Winnipeg

Section 1: Key Characteristics & Appeal

This bi-level home at 411 Ferry Road in the King Edward neighbourhood presents a practical and efficient living option. Its key characteristic is its modern build date (1993), making it significantly newer than most homes on its street and across Winnipeg. This suggests potentially fewer immediate concerns with aging infrastructure compared to century-old properties. The living space is compact at 795 sq ft, which is below average for the city but typical for the immediate area, and it features a renovated basement. The lot size is modest, and there is no garage.

The appeal lies in its value proposition as a relatively contemporary, low-maintenance entry point into the Winnipeg market. It suits first-time buyers, investors, or downsizers seeking an affordable home without the surprises often found in much older properties. Its assessed value is squarely average for its local context, indicating a stable, no-frills investment rather than an undervalued project. A thoughtful perspective is that while the home's size is modest, its newer age could mean lower ongoing maintenance costs, effectively allocating a budget towards quality of life rather than constant repairs. It’s a home for those who prioritize simplicity and modern fundamentals over square footage or historic charm.

Section 2: Frequently Asked Questions

1. How does the 1993 build date impact this home?
Positively, as it is newer than roughly 80% of homes in King Edward. This typically means more modern wiring, plumbing, and insulation, leading to greater energy efficiency and potentially lower maintenance costs than the neighbourhood's many heritage-era homes.

2. Is the living space too small?
At 795 sq ft, it is below the city average but comparable to other homes on Ferry Road. The renovated basement adds functional space. This layout suits individuals, couples, or small families comfortable with efficient, cozy living.

3. What does the "around average" assessed value mean for the price?
It indicates the property is not an outlier. Its value is consistent with similar properties on the street and in King Edward, suggesting a market-based price rather than a steep discount or premium. It’s a benchmark for stability.

4. What are the implications of having no garage?
Parking will be on-street. This is common for the area but is a consideration for those with multiple vehicles or who desire protected parking. The modest lot size also limits the potential for adding a garage later.

5. How does this home compare to others in Winnipeg?
City-wide, it sits in the lower tier for living and land area but in the top tier for its newer age. This highlights its niche: a newer, compact home in an established neighbourhood, offering a different trade-off than an older, larger house for a similar price.
